About This Book
The book presents a concise, single-term survey of United States history arranged in chronological epochs—from early discoveries and colonial development through the Revolution, the growth of the states, the Civil War, and Reconstruction—augmented by maps, questions, and topical headings to aid classroom study. It emphasizes select key events and memorable features of battles, links leading dates, explains causes and effects, and includes footnote sketches of prominent officeholders and appendices of foundational documents and review exercises. Pedagogical guidance for map work, recitation, and topical study is provided throughout to support teachers and students.
